WebThe actual reason for the laws is this: If q is false, so is p ∧ q, so p ∧ ⊥ is always false. Similarly, if q is true, then so is p ∨ q, because then p is true OR q is true. WebChapter: 12th Maths : UNIT 12 : Discrete Mathematics Some Laws of Logical Equivalence Any two compound statements A and B are said to be logically equivalent or simply equivalent if the columns corresponding to A and B in the truth table have identical truth values. Mathematical Logic Logical Equivalence Definition 12.20 WebAug 25, 2024 · 1. Argument – A sequence of statements, premises, that end with a conclusion. 2. Validity – A deductive argument is said to be valid if and only if it takes a form that makes it impossible for the premises to be true and the conclusion nevertheless to be false. 3. WebJun 25, 2024 · The most basic form of logic is propositional logic. Propositions, which have no variables, are the only assertions that are considered. Because there are no variables in propositions, they are either always true or always false . Example – P : 2 + 4 = 5. (Always False) is a proposition. Q : y * 0 = 0. (Always true) is a proposition. WebMay 10, 2024 · To do it algebraically, there are distributive laws for compositions of "and" and "or", and the one that we want is P ∨ ( Q ∧ R) ≡ ( P ∨ Q) ∧ ( P ∨ R). Clearly your P is w, so that by working backwards you have ( h ∨ w) ∧ ( ¬ h ∨ w) ≡ w ∨ ( h ∧ ¬ h).
